"Enziteto Real Estate."
Italian street artists recently took to the Enziteto neighborhood in Bari, South Italy to put up some rather impressive murals. The project was organized by Pigment Workroom, a start-up seeking to give artists spaces to work in and to allow them to experiment with their work. Artists for this first project included Italian street artists: Tellas, Alberonero, Geometric Bang, Alfano and Ciredz. See more of the murals below!




Towering Animals by ‘Irony & Boe’ Stalk the Streets of London









Hot on the heels of yesterday’s post about an enormous dog mural by Smates in Belgium, here’s another great collection of humongous animals by UK duo Irony & Boe (aka. Whoam Irony and Placee Boe). The pair have collaborated on several large pieces in London over the last year including this wacky chihuahua that appeared on Chrisp Street in East London about a month ago. Dramatic Tornadoes of Light Photographed by Martin Kimbell







Martin Kimbell is a photographer from England who utilizes LEDs and long exposure techniques to create airborne light forms that seem like trails of otherworldy spacecraft. My initial assumption was that Kimbell used some form of small drone with attached lights, similar to Andreas Feininger’s work with helicopters back in 1949, but the photographs are instead made with hoops lined with LEDs that are hurled into the air. Kimbell was inspired early on by the work of Arizona-based photographer Stu Jenks who uses light and fire to create similar tornado-like images. You can see more of Kimbell’s work over on Flickr.
